I am trying to make sure these are not vermeted snails. They are all over my rock and fairly small. I also noticed that the rock is full of the white tiny little curly things. Please help. My tank is 5 month old.

Welcome to R2R!
The curly things are a calcarious filter feeder, like a mini feather duster. Harmless. The concentration will come and go, but will always be there. Both them and the Pineapple sponges are a great sign you are doing things right!
